Ignorance in mysticism is treated as a supreme virtue

HERE’S THE INTERESTING PART

While society praises massive intellects, mystics consider knowing too much a critical handicap. Learned ignorance is the conscious realization that human logic is incapable of grasping the infinite. By actively unlearning their rigidly constructed intellectual frameworks, seekers purposefully lobotomize their egos to make room for absolute truth.
